Cataract Surgery
Phacoemulsification removal of a clouded lens and replacement with an artificial intraocular lens (IOL), typically performed as an outpatient procedure.
medical-procedures
Root Canal Treatment
Endodontic treatment to remove infected pulp tissue from root canals, followed by sealing and crown placement to save the tooth.
medical-procedures
Dental Implant
Titanium implant surgically placed in the jawbone as a permanent tooth root, followed by abutment and crown placement over 3-6 months.
medical-procedures
Dental Bridge
Fixed prosthetic device that replaces one or more missing teeth by anchoring to adjacent natural teeth or implants. Includes tooth preparation, impressions, temporary bridge, and final cementation.
medical-procedures
Dental Bonding
Cosmetic dental procedure where tooth-colored composite resin is applied and hardened with UV light to repair chips, cracks, gaps, or discoloration. Typically completed in a single visit.
medical-procedures
Professional Teeth Whitening
In-office teeth whitening using high-concentration h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ide gel with LED or laser activation. Results in several shades of lightening in a single 60 to 90 minute session.
